nutsInclusion Technologies LLC has just introduced an all-natural and non-GMO version of their 100% nut-free Nadanut™nut analogs.  This new product line extension is based on stabilized wheat germ and expeller pressed oil with natural antioxidants and natural colors and flavors and will be available in a variety of sizes and shapes and nut varieties such as Almond, Pecan, Walnut, Hazelnut, and Peanut.  Chris Jansen, President of Inclusion Technologies said “ this new product offering was developed to satisfy the growing demand in North America, but also for our potential EU, Asian, and Middle East customers”.

Nadanut™applications are very diverse, essentially wherever real nuts are used. Dennis Reid, Vice President of Marketing and Business Development said “There are 2 billion pounds of nuts used as ingredients in the Industrial Marketplace. Nadanut products give the Industry a way to still enjoy the look, taste, and texture of real nuts, without the high cost or issues related to nut allergens; these products are 100% nut-free and less than half the cost of nuts.”  The company will be showcasing this new Nadanut™Naturals line at the upcoming Natural Products West/Engredea trade show in Anaheim on March 6-8 in booth #8210.

About Inclusion Technologies LLC

 Based in Atchison Kansas, Inclusion Technologies, LLC is a new ingredient and management company focused on investments and acquisitions in the food inclusion space.  Through a planned “buy and build” strategy, along with planned strategic alliances, the company’s goal is to develop a broad-based portfolio of specialty inclusions focused on innovative ingredient solutions and supported by superior customer service.
